سرویس Kubernetes

Kubernetes (یا به اختصار K8s) یک سیستم مدیریت خوشه‌های کانتینری است که برای اجرا و مدیریت برنامه‌ها و سرویس‌های مبتنی بر کانتینرها در محیط‌های توزیع‌شده طراحی شده است. این پلتفرم متن‌باز توسط Google توسعه یافته و به عنوان یکی از قدرتمندترین ابزارهای ارتقاء و انتقال به محیط‌های محاسباتی ابری و اجرایی شناخته می‌شود. Kubernetes امکانات متنوعی از جمله خودکارسازی، انطباق به شرایط تغییرات، توزیع بار، ایجاد، مدیریت، و نظارت بر کانتینرها و برنامه‌ها را فراهم می‌کند. این سیستم از مفاهیمی مانند خدمات، کنترلرها، پایگاه‌داده‌های انتخابی و ترافیک مدیریتی برای تسهیل و بهینه‌سازی توسعه، مقیاس‌پذیری و مدیریت برنامه‌های پیچیده استفاده می‌کند. با استفاده از Kubernetes، توسعه‌دهندگان می‌توانند برنامه‌های خود را با سطح بالا از انعطاف‌پذیری و ایمنی توسعه دهند، در حالی که مدیران سیستم می‌توانند منابع محیط مجازی‌سازی و ابری را به بهره‌وری بالا مدیریت کنند. این به شرکت‌ها امکان مهاجرت به معماری‌های میکروسرویس‌ها و ایجاد محیط‌های توسعه و تولید کیفیت بالا را می‌دهد.


برخی از قابلیت های Kubernetes :

  • مدیریت کانتینرها: Kubernetes به شما امکان مدیریت و اجرای کانتینرهای Docker و دیگر کانتینرها را می‌دهد.
  • استقرار و مقیاس‌پذیری: شما می‌توانید برنامه‌های خود را با Kubernetes به سرعت و به صورت مقیاس‌پذیر در محیط توزیع شده اجرا کنید.
  • مدیریت ترافیک: Kubernetes ابزارهای متنوعی برای مدیریت ترافیک و توزیع بار در برنامه‌های شما ارائه می‌دهد.
  • پشتیبانی از استراژ فراگیر: شما می‌توانید از انواع استراژهای مختلف برای ذخیره داده‌های برنامه‌های خود در Kubernetes استفاده کنید.
  • تکمیلی برای محیط‌های چندسروره: Kubernetes به شما امکان مدیریت برنامه‌های خود در محیط‌های چندسروره و چندانتقالی را می‌دهد.
  • توانایی ایجاد محیط‌های متعدد: شما می‌توانید محیط‌های جداگانه برای توسعه، تست و تولید ایجاد کنید.
  • مدیریت اتوماتیک: Kubernetes به شما امکانات مدیریت اتوماتیک تعداد کانتینرها و برنامه‌های خود را فراهم می‌کند.
  • پیکربندی متناسب با کد: Kubernetes به شما اجازه می‌دهد پیکربندی برنامه‌های خود را با کد منطقی کرده و به صورت دائمی مدیریت کنید.
  • مانیتورینگ و لاگ‌گیری: Kubernetes ابزارهای مانیتورینگ عملکرد برنامه‌ها و لاگ‌گیری برای تحلیل و رفع مشکلات فراهم می‌کند.



برخی از خدمات ما برای Kubernetes :

    • ✅ مشاوره و برنامه‌ریزی: ما با شما همکاری می‌کنیم تا نیازها و اهداف شما را برای نصب Kubernetes درک کنیم.
    • ✅ تنظیم محیط: ما به شما کمک می‌کنیم محیط سرورها و شبکه‌های شما را برای استفاده از Kubernetes آماده کنید.
    • ✅ نصب و پیکربندی Kubernetes: ما Kubernetes را بر روی سرورهای شما نصب و پیکربندی می‌کنیم.
    • ✅ مدیریت ترافیک: ما به شما کمک می‌کنیم ترافیک برنامه‌های شما را به صورت بهینه مدیریت کنید.
    • ✅ ایجاد محیط‌های توسعه: ما محیط‌های توسعه برای توسعه‌دهندگان شما در Kubernetes ایجاد می‌کنیم.
    • ✅ امنیت و دسترسی کنترلی: ما امنیت کلاسیک مدیریت اصولی کانتینرهای Kubernetes و دسترسی به آنها را تضمین می‌کنیم.
    • ✅ آموزش و آگاهی‌دهی: ما به تیم شما آموزش می‌دهیم تا بتوانند به بهترین شکل از Kubernetes استفاده کنند.
    • ✅ پشتیبانی فنی ۲۴/۷: ما خدمات پشتیبانی فنی ۲۴/۷ برای حل مشکلات و سوالات فنی ارائه می‌دهیم.
    • ✅ مدیریت اتوماتیک: ما به شما ابزارها و راهکارهای مدیریت اتوماتیک کانتینرها در Kubernetes را ارائه می‌دهیم.
    • ✅ مانیتورینگ و لاگ‌گیری: ما به شما ابزارهای مانیتورینگ و لاگ‌گیری برای رصد و تحلیل عملکرد Kubernetes ارائه می‌دهیم.